Anyone know where to buy 1" - 1 1/2" rainbow trout colored floating minnow lures that have a single treble on the back of them? Anything similar to this that won't dive more than a few feet on a somewhat brisk retrieve?

Several years ago I bought like 20 of them at a hardware store I can't remember for very, very cheap. The brand was no-name and I can't seem to find a similar lure anywhere. These became my go-to lures for those "clear rainy days" when its raining or just got done raining and its still bright out rather than grey. I lost my last one today :(

The ultralight minnows by rapala sink. I bought some for trout fishing and they do work but they are all countdowns, but they do sink much slower than the countdown rapalas do. Probably worth trying though as they aren't very expensive.

try the size 3 floating rapala.. it comes in rainbow trout and is the size you are looking for
